diff --git a/demos/base-path/netlify.toml b/demos/base-path/netlify.toml index 20fa9eb296..7ca6315cf2 100644 --- a/demos/base-path/netlify.toml +++ b/demos/base-path/netlify.toml @@ -1,7 +1,7 @@ [build] command = "next build" publish = ".next" -ignore = "git diff --quiet $CACHED_COMMIT_REF $COMMIT_REF ../../" +ignore = "if [ $CACHED_COMMIT_REF == $COMMIT_REF ]; then (exit 1); else git diff --quiet $CACHED_COMMIT_REF $COMMIT_REF . ../../plugin; fi;" [build.environment] # cache Cypress binary in local "node_modules" folder diff --git a/demos/default/netlify.toml b/demos/default/netlify.toml index e85f79dcbb..4601d249b0 100644 --- a/demos/default/netlify.toml +++ b/demos/default/netlify.toml @@ -1,7 +1,7 @@ [build] command = "next build" publish = ".next" -ignore = "git diff --quiet $CACHED_COMMIT_REF $COMMIT_REF ../.." +ignore = "if [ $CACHED_COMMIT_REF == $COMMIT_REF ]; then (exit 1); else git diff --quiet $CACHED_COMMIT_REF $COMMIT_REF . ../../plugin; fi;" [build.environment] # cache Cypress binary in local "node_modules" folder diff --git a/demos/middleware/netlify.toml b/demos/middleware/netlify.toml index 8140d0c2e4..dc100705ea 100644 --- a/demos/middleware/netlify.toml +++ b/demos/middleware/netlify.toml @@ -1,6 +1,7 @@ [build] command = "npm run build" publish = ".next" +ignore = "if [ $CACHED_COMMIT_REF == $COMMIT_REF ]; then (exit 1); else git diff --quiet $CACHED_COMMIT_REF $COMMIT_REF . ../../plugin; fi;" [build.environment] NEXT_USE_NETLIFY_EDGE = "true" diff --git a/demos/next-auth/netlify.toml b/demos/next-auth/netlify.toml index 3878fcc1eb..bf94c6194d 100644 --- a/demos/next-auth/netlify.toml +++ b/demos/next-auth/netlify.toml @@ -1,7 +1,7 @@ [build] command = "next build" publish = ".next" -ignore = "git diff --quiet $CACHED_COMMIT_REF $COMMIT_REF . ../../plugin" +ignore = "if [ $CACHED_COMMIT_REF == $COMMIT_REF ]; then (exit 1); else git diff --quiet $CACHED_COMMIT_REF $COMMIT_REF . ../../plugin; fi;" [build.environment] TERM = "xterm" diff --git a/demos/next-export/netlify.toml b/demos/next-export/netlify.toml index bc4ebaa0f9..7f32cb809b 100644 --- a/demos/next-export/netlify.toml +++ b/demos/next-export/netlify.toml @@ -1,7 +1,7 @@ [build] command = "next build && next export" publish = "out" -ignore = "git diff --quiet $CACHED_COMMIT_REF $COMMIT_REF ../../" +ignore = "if [ $CACHED_COMMIT_REF == $COMMIT_REF ]; then (exit 1); else git diff --quiet $CACHED_COMMIT_REF $COMMIT_REF . ../../plugin; fi;" [build.environment] NETLIFY_NEXT_PLUGIN_SKIP = "true" diff --git a/demos/next-i18next/netlify.toml b/demos/next-i18next/netlify.toml index 870b965b86..a75ca81b8d 100644 --- a/demos/next-i18next/netlify.toml +++ b/demos/next-i18next/netlify.toml @@ -1,7 +1,7 @@ [build] command = "next build" publish = ".next" -ignore = "git diff --quiet $CACHED_COMMIT_REF $COMMIT_REF . ../../plugin" +ignore = "if [ $CACHED_COMMIT_REF == $COMMIT_REF ]; then (exit 1); else git diff --quiet $CACHED_COMMIT_REF $COMMIT_REF . ../../plugin; fi;" [build.environment] TERM = "xterm" diff --git a/demos/nx-next-monorepo-demo/netlify.toml b/demos/nx-next-monorepo-demo/netlify.toml index 04b61ce83d..7396fe00b8 100644 --- a/demos/nx-next-monorepo-demo/netlify.toml +++ b/demos/nx-next-monorepo-demo/netlify.toml @@ -1,7 +1,7 @@ [build] command = "npm run build" publish = "dist/apps/demo-monorepo/.next" -ignore = "git diff --quiet $CACHED_COMMIT_REF $COMMIT_REF ../../" +ignore = "if [ $CACHED_COMMIT_REF == $COMMIT_REF ]; then (exit 1); else git diff --quiet $CACHED_COMMIT_REF $COMMIT_REF . ../../plugin; fi;" [dev] command = "npm run start" diff --git a/demos/server-components/netlify.toml b/demos/server-components/netlify.toml index 70c0e0e788..dc100705ea 100644 --- a/demos/server-components/netlify.toml +++ b/demos/server-components/netlify.toml @@ -1,7 +1,7 @@ [build] command = "npm run build" publish = ".next" -ignore = "git diff --quiet $CACHED_COMMIT_REF $COMMIT_REF ../.." +ignore = "if [ $CACHED_COMMIT_REF == $COMMIT_REF ]; then (exit 1); else git diff --quiet $CACHED_COMMIT_REF $COMMIT_REF . ../../plugin; fi;" [build.environment] NEXT_USE_NETLIFY_EDGE = "true" diff --git a/demos/static-root/netlify.toml b/demos/static-root/netlify.toml index 47f2a4b667..3b6bb5e115 100644 --- a/demos/static-root/netlify.toml +++ b/demos/static-root/netlify.toml @@ -1,7 +1,7 @@ [build] command = "next build" publish = ".next" -ignore = "git diff --quiet $CACHED_COMMIT_REF $COMMIT_REF ../../" +ignore = "if [ $CACHED_COMMIT_REF == $COMMIT_REF ]; then (exit 1); else git diff --quiet $CACHED_COMMIT_REF $COMMIT_REF . ../../plugin; fi;" [build.environment] # cache Cypress binary in local "node_modules" folder